Muzorewa wrote:Is there grass alongside the pitches to enable an awning to be pitched there, or do you have to set both your Bongo and awning up on the hardstanding?
There is no grass on or near any of the pitches. This was us on Sunday.

Image

Ours friends stuck an awning up but trashed their regular pegs so gave up and borrowed our rock pegs and they went in well. :D
The plus side of a complete hardstanding pitch is NO MUD =D> After all, this is the lakes where it rains - a lot. Hence the lakes :wink:
